Who Was She?? What Did She Do??

Caroline was mostly known for her involvment with femal immigrant welfare in Australia. She was a kind hearted person who would help the homless and unemployed women on the street's who needed a new start. She was the youngest of a large family, and had grown up believing that God needed her to look after the poor. She would bring them in as her own, feed them, and give them all of the tender loving care they needed.

 

After many years of helping those in need without recieving anything in return Caroline passed away on the 25th of March in 1877. Her husband diedin the next August and was burried in the same grave in Northampton, leaving their three sons and two daughters behind.
